I had to tighten the torsion springs after adding horizontal wind bracing to my garage door (I live in Houston). First I marked the bars with electrical tape to insure they got the all the way in the socket to prevent slippage. Then winding was not difficult.

Long story short, hurricane came power was lost for a few days, husband put the manual slash on without telling me. So power came back on and I wanted to take the trash out. When I tried to open it, it got stuck!! Yes, I broke it but it was his fault😒, the top panel was bent… and so we called a well known garage door company, gave 2 quotes: $1500 for a panel or $4000 for a whole door. So we called back wanted just 1 panel and they said unfortunately our door has discontinued (our house is only 6 years old), HOA said it could be any brand too, back and forth, this no good that no good, leave us the only option was to replace the whole thing. My husband was like dude, seriously? So he started looking for solutions on YouTube. Videos shown how and what to get to fix similar problems. We replaced the bar and the door popped back out by itself. And it only cost a little over $100 and 2 hours. So yes, I highly recommend this!

I bought this item due to the measurements listed on the product review. It said the two large pieces were 7' 9" and the third (middle) piece was 3' 11". I needed the 3' 11" to secure to two vertical beams. Support was compromised. The actual measurement was 2'. Had to Frankenstein pieces to make it work. Frustrating expecting what it was advertised as and get something way off. Also, it was missing 5 plastic washers for the small screws provided. Once again I had to improvise.

The media could not be loaded. When a hinge broke on my 16-ft wide garage door, the door sagged and prevented me from opening or closing it. I made a temporary fix with angle iron but the door still did not work well. When I purchased this support system I found it to be very easy to install, the threaded screws worked perfectly and within 30 minutes my door was better than new.I followed the directions, installed the 3-ft center section, then added the two 8-ft pieces that meet in the middle. Though the holes provided did not line up with existing holes on the door, my Ryobi drill driver easily drove the screws into the heavy duty support and the door panel supports behind it. I was glad that the garage door installation company was so busy that they were not able to get out to my house for a couple of days. That gave me time to order and install this support that fixed the problem and saved me a lot of money.
